Who is already there, emerging market
Alteryx provides a platform for data preparation, blending, and analytics automation using a code-free interface.
Pricing: Starts at approximately $5,195 per user per year for Alteryx Designer; enterprise pricing for Alteryx Server is customized based on deployment and users.
Talend offers comprehensive data management, integration, and data quality solutions.
Pricing: Pricing is not publicly available and is contract-based.
Fivetran is an ETL tool that automates data integration from various sources into data warehouses.
Pricing: Free tier available for up to 500,000 monthly active rows (MAR) for connections, 3,500 MAR for activations, and 5,000 monthly model runs (MMR) for transformations. Paid plans are usage-based on Monthly Active Rows (MAR) with a $5 base charge for standard connections; pricing can become unpredictable and high with increased data volume and multiple connectors.
Dataiku is an end-to-end data science platform for teams to build and deploy predictive models and data pipelines.
Pricing: Pricing is not transparent; users report a rating of 3/5 for price.
Palantir Foundry is a platform that integrates data transformation, analysis, and operational deployment into a unified workflow, connecting siloed data sources.
Pricing: Not publicly disclosed; typically enterprise-level and customized.
Datameer Enterprise is a cloud-based data preparation and analytics service that handles structured and semi-structured information, automating mundane tasks with machine learning.
Pricing: Starts at $100 with a free-forever plan.
Keboola is a cloud-based data integration and analytics orchestration platform.
Pricing: Usage-based pricing with a credit system.
OpenRefine is a free, open-source tool for cleaning messy data, transforming formats, and extending it with web services.
Pricing: Free and open-source.

Market signals
The data preparation market is large and growing, with the ETL market alone projected to reach $21.25 billion by 2031. Recent trends indicate a shift towards cloud-native architectures, self-service analytics, and the increasing integration of AI/ML capabilities for automated data cleaning and transformation. There is also a growing demand for predictable pricing models, moving away from unpredictable usage-based costs.
